A lightweight Persistent storage solution for Kubernetes / OpenShift / Nomad using GlusterFS in background. More information at https://kadalu.tech
OTHER License
Bot releases are hidden (Show)
Published by aravindavk about 3 years ago
The Kadalu team is happy to announce a new version of Kadalu Storage, 0.8.5
kadalu_storage_pv_capacity_bytes
, kadalu_storage_pv_capacity_used_bytes
and kadalu_storage_pv_capacity_free_bytes
Published by aravindavk about 3 years ago
Published by aravindavk over 3 years ago
Published by amarts over 3 years ago
Published by amarts over 3 years ago
series_1
branch).Published by amarts over 3 years ago
Published by aravindavk over 3 years ago
Published by amarts over 3 years ago
This is a test release to check the linux/arm64
and linux/arm/v7
builds with 0.8.x series.
Also expected to reduce the image sizes further.
NOTE: not recommended to upgrade to the release.
Published by amarts over 3 years ago
This is an upgraded release in the 0.8 series of kadalu project.
linux/arm64
and linux/arm/v7
are still not enabled.linux/arm64
and want to experiment 0.8.x series can try arm
tag of kadalu images.series_1
branch of kadalu/glusterfs. Includes many stability fixes, including few in replicate translator.quotad
in server brick pods anymore. Reduces confusing logskubectl kadalu status
command, which failed with missing sqlite3 package on serverGeneral Note: If you are upgrading from 0.7.x series, team recommends to wait till one more version. Mainly due to multiple changes which were done in 0.8 series. All new users (or new setups) and users of 0.8.0 version are advised to upgrade.
Published by amarts over 3 years ago
Few things which changes with this release: (compared to 0.7.x series)
Platform Note:
linux/arm64
and linux/arm/v7
platform is not supported in this release.Other details:
kubectl kadalu logs
kubectl kadalu healinfo
So what are the benefits for users:
kubectl apply -f
again.** General Note **: Team recommends users who have successfully running kadalu instance with 0.7.x version to not yet upgrade to this release, mainly as there are multiple changes in this release.
Published by amarts over 3 years ago
Few things which changes with this release: (compared to 0.7.x series)
kubectl kadalu logs
kubectl kadalu healinfo
So what are the benefits for users:
kubectl apply -f
again.Published by amarts over 3 years ago
Few things which changes with this release: (compared to 0.7.x series)
kubectl kadalu logs
kubectl kadalu healinfo
So what are the benefits for users:
kubectl apply -f
again.Published by amarts over 3 years ago
Few things which changes with this release:
kubectl kadalu logs
kubectl kadalu healinfo
So what are the benefits for users:
kubectl apply -f
again.Published by amarts over 3 years ago
Few things which changes with this release:
kubectl kadalu logs
kubectl kadalu healinfo
So what are the benefits for users:
kubectl apply -f
again.Published by amarts over 3 years ago
Few things which changes with this release:
kubectl kadalu healinfo
So what are the benefits for users:
kubectl apply -f
again.Published by amarts over 3 years ago
Few things which changes with this release:
* use kadalu-storage (glusterfs fork of kadalu, which adds features like simple-quota etc).
* changes in templates to accomodate distribute volumes
* remove usage of -oprjquota on mount
* use simple quota limit feature to set the quota
* simplify the brick volfile generation, and make it uniform across
* provide 'client-pid' to clients mounted in csi controller (for simple-quota)
* fix the template files
* include quota-crawler with provisioner
* Added support for self heal info into CLI - can be checked with `kubectl kadalu healinfo`
* Added support for prometheus monitoring, so all of kadalu's pods can send crucial metrics to prometheus server.
So what are the benefits for users:
* Instead of creating multiple host volumes of same type, they can use just one volume with all bricks
- Scalling of the host volume is just adding storage to config and calling `kubectl apply -f` again.
* Any backend filesystem which supports extended attributes can be used on devices.
* no requirement of 'quotad' process
Published by amarts over 3 years ago
This is a minor release of kadalu, with below improvements over 0.7.6. With this release, glusterfs used in kadalu pods are now glusterfs-8 series, instead of previous glusterfs-7 (7.2 to be precise) earlier. Which fixes multiple issues with glusterfs, and is currently maintained series in glusterfs.
c4b49e0 cli: Fix parsing the device or path list (#428) - Fixed #427
c453713 server: try performing mkfs only if mount fails (#420) - Fixed #419
c7ab07e cli: use the release version as default while using release package (#421) - Fixed #418
d70fffe csi: handle the case where 'kadalu' storageclass is used (#416) - Fixed #400, #399
61d16c4 Install latest version of GlusterFS (#430)
06206d5 tests: check for 2 success in external PVC type (#422)
Published by amarts almost 4 years ago
With this release, kadalu project brings many improvements, and few beta features.
arm/v7
platformAnd also it adds few minor fixes:
Do give it a try and let us know the feedback.
Published by amarts almost 4 years ago
This is a minor release in 0.7.x series with few major enhancements since 0.7.4
Published by amarts almost 4 years ago
This is a minor release with few important long term changes:
also 2 minor issues fixed from that of previous minor version: #376 & #359